5 Key Factors to Consider When Allocating Your Marketing Budget
In the dynamic landscape of modern enterprise, allocating your marketing budget effectively is crucial for achieving optimal results and maximizing return on investment (ROI). With numerous platforms, strategies, and applied sciences available, deciding where to allocate your marketing funds could be challenging. Nevertheless, by careabsolutely considering the following key factors, you can make informed choices that align with what you are promoting goals and target audience.
Clear Targets and Target Viewers:
Before allocating your marketing budget, it's essential to determine clear objectives and determine your goal audience. Understanding who your clients are, their preferences, behaviors, and pain points, lets you tailor your marketing efforts effectively. Whether your goal is to increase brand awareness, generate leads, drive sales, or enhance buyer loyalty, aligning your budget allocation with these goals ensures that each dollar spent contributes to achieving tangible results. Conducting thorough market research and leveraging data analytics can provide valuable insights into your target market's demographics, interests, and buying habits, enabling you to allocate your resources more efficiently.
ROI Evaluation and Performance Metrics:
Implementing a robust system for tracking and analyzing the ROI of your marketing initiatives is indispensable for making informed budget allocation decisions. By measuring key performance indicators (KPIs) comparable to conversion rates, buyer acquisition value (CAC), customer lifetime worth (CLV), and return on ad spend (ROAS), you possibly can consider the effectiveness of different marketing channels and campaigns. Allocate a significant portion of your budget to channels and strategies that deliver the highest ROI, while constantly monitoring performance and making adjustments primarily based on real-time data insights. Investing in marketing attribution tools and analytics platforms empowers you to quantify the impact of your marketing efforts accurately and optimize your budget allocation accordingly.
